Synopsis
Requiring a person to hold a common carrier permit to ship premium cigars or pipe tobacco in the State; authorizing the Executive Director of the Alcohol and Tobacco Commission to take certain action regarding a certain license if the use of the licensed premises does not conform to certain provisions of law; authorizing the Executive Director to conduct certain inspections and searches without a warrant; requiring a study on identifying and eliminating barriers to minority participation in the alcoholic beverages industry; etc.
